It is preserved during re-boot and synchronized if there are two routing 
engines.

>Does anyone know if JUNOS maintains the ordering on it's SNMP interface
>ID's after a reboot?  We've seen Cisco routers change interface IDs and we
>found a command in IOS to make them persistant:
>
>snmp-server ifindex persist
>
>Is there an equivalent setting in JUNOS?
